WebDec 7, 2024 · You can bring cigarettes on the plane in your carry-on or checked bags. No TSA rules limit the number of cigarettes. If you are flying internationally, your destination may have limits on tobacco products allowed in the country, but airport security, when boarding the plane, will not check on these rules. It will be up to the customs agents at ...
